How to check your Loan Against Property payment status?

Through the lender’s online portal – Log in to your lender’s customer portal using your credentials to view EMI payments, outstanding balances, and loan details.

Via mobile banking apps – Many lenders offer mobile apps where you can track payment history, check due dates, and set reminders for future EMIs.

By reviewing your bank statement – Check your bank account for EMI deductions to confirm that payments are processed successfully.

Requesting a loan statement – You can download or request a loan account statement from your lender’s website or customer service.

Through SMS and email alerts – Lenders send notifications regarding successful EMI payments, upcoming due dates, and any overdue amounts. Ensure notifications are enabled.

Contact customer support – If you face issues accessing payment details online, call or email your lender’s customer service for clarification.

Visiting the lender’s branch – If digital methods are unavailable, visit the nearest lender branch and request an updated loan statement.

Using net banking auto-debit records – If you have set up auto-debit for EMI payments, check your net banking records for transaction confirmations.

Checking third-party financial tracking apps – Some personal finance apps allow users to sync their loans and track payments easily.

Requesting a physical loan statement – If required, you can ask your lender for a printed loan account statement for verification.

Common issues while checking loan payment status

Login issues on lender’s portal – Incorrect credentials, server downtime, or technical errors can prevent access. Reset your password or try later.

Delayed payment updates – Some payments may take up to 48 hours to reflect, causing confusion. Always check after a reasonable time.

Incorrect outstanding balance – Due to system updates or manual errors, the displayed balance may not match actual dues. Verify through a quarterly payment for loan against property statement.

Missing EMI payment confirmation – If you don’t receive SMS or email confirmation, check your bank transaction history for proof.

Double EMI deduction – Sometimes, systems process duplicate EMI deductions. If affected, report the issue and request a refund through double EMI deduction support.

Incorrect loan account details – Errors in loan tenure, EMI amount, or due dates can appear. Cross-check with your original loan agreement.

Unresponsive customer support – Long wait times or unhelpful responses can delay issue resolution. Use multiple support channels like email, chatbot, or branch visits.

Bank auto-debit failures – If auto-debit is enabled but an EMI is not deducted, insufficient funds or technical issues could be the cause. Contact your lender.

Hidden charges in loan statements – Some discrepancies arise due to additional charges like processing fees or penalties. Review the statement carefully.

Blocked or suspended loan account – Repeated failed logins or unpaid overdue amounts may restrict account access. Clear pending dues and request account reactivation.

Tips to ensure timely loan payments

Set up auto-debit for EMIs – Enable automatic EMI deductions to avoid late payments and penalties.

Maintain sufficient balance – Keep funds available in your linked account before the EMI due date.

Use payment reminders – Set mobile or email alerts to get notified about upcoming payments.

Check loan statements regularly – Reviewing your quarterly payment for loan against property helps ensure accurate tracking.

Verify EMI amounts before payment – Any change in interest rates or tenure can affect EMI amounts. Confirm before making a payment.

Monitor auto-debit transactions – Regularly check your account for successful EMI deductions to avoid double EMI deduction or missed payments.

Clear overdue payments quickly – Delays can increase interest charges and affect your credit score. Settle overdue amounts immediately.

Use multiple payment options – If one method fails, use online banking, UPI, or credit card payments to avoid delays.

Update contact information with your lender – Ensure you receive all SMS and email alerts related to your loan.

Track your loan repayment history – Maintaining records of past EMI payments helps in resolving disputes and planning future repayments effectively.

Frequently asked questions

How can I check my loan against property payment status?
You can check your Loan Against Property payment status via the lender’s online portal, mobile app, bank statements, or by reviewing your quarterly payment for loan against property.

What information do I need to check my loan payment status?
You typically need your loan account number, registered mobile number, and login credentials to access loan details through the lender’s portal or app.

Can I track loan payments via mobile apps?
Yes, most lenders offer mobile banking apps that allow you to track EMI payments, outstanding balances, and receive alerts for upcoming dues.

What should I do if I find discrepancies in my loan status?
Immediately contact your lender’s customer service, check your bank statements, and review your quarterly payment for loan against property to verify payment details and resolve errors.
